The components of the IPTV codes are: the server address, port, username, and password. These four elements are essential for establishing a connection with the IPTV server. By inputting the correct IPTV code, it makes the whole process effortless and efficient.

It's worth emphasizing that IPTV codes don't provide the content itself. Rather, they are an access point to the service where your selected content resides. In simpler terms, without these codes, IPTV functionality is impossible.

Now, where can one find these IPTV codes? Usually, they are provided by the IPTV service provider either through an email or on their main website. It is also imperative to remember not to share your IPTV codes as they are tied to your specific subscription. Unauthorised access can lead to service interruptions or even complete shutdown.
